The public schools with the highest share of Asian students in Hill County, Texas

This ranking covers the public schools with the highest share of Asian students in Hill County, Texas, drawn from 20 qualifying public schools. HUBBARD EL leads the list at 1.9%, against a median of 0.4% across the ranked schools.
